      First, it depends on how you define your terms.  The Vietnamese fought Japanese occupation from 1940 until 1945, largely under HoChih Minh.  Minh was actually under the employ of the OSS during the Japanese occupation.  After 1945, Vietnam more or less (the details are complicated) reverted to a French colony.  Only problem was that Vietnam did not want to be a colony.  The French faced increasing opposition, ultimately facing armed resistance by 1950 (the year many are pointing out here).  The French Army fought a resistance movement called the Vietminh, and lost a major battle to the Vietminh at Dienbienphu in 1954.  The French, capitalizing on Ho Chih Minh's communism and the Truman Doctrine, requested US assistance.  Ultimately, an accord was reached to have country wide elections, but the US ultimately urged the South Vietnamese leadership (Ho's base of power was in the north) and conservative elements in the French supported and created Army of the Republic of Vietnam to back out of the agreement.  As a result, by the late 1950's, South Vietnam was ruled by an unpopular president (Diem) and was drawing in more and more US troops as advisers.  In 1963, Diem was assassinated by military leaders (US officials were aware of the plot, but stood by and did nothing) in a coup, leaving South Vietnam being ruled by a military oligarchy throughout much of the 1960's.  Increasingly, this oligarchy requested more and more aid from a US who was concerned about Mao's takeover in China in 1949 and the Korean War cease fire of 1954.

      The sum total of this is that there was no "Pearl Harbor" moment to "begin" the Vietnam War.  Like most history, the beginnings are imprecise, messy, and often do not look like a beginning at the time they happen.
